Switch the input referring to “Input Source” on page 63.
2 Turn on the connected device, and start playback.
The picture will appear on the LCD screen or viewfinder of this DVD video camera/ recorder.
3 Press the REC button.
Recording will start on this DVD video camera/recorder.

•The recorded contents can be played back in the same manner as when playing back camera images recorded on this DVD video camera/recorder.
•The “Input Source” setting will return to “CAMERA” whenever DVD video camera/recorder is turned off.
•Recording of most images is prohibited by the copy- guard signal to protect the copyright, except for images recorded on camcorders for personal enjoyment. “COPY PROTECTED” appears in these images: They cannot be recorded on this DVD video camera/recorder.
Typical copyright protected images include those of DVD video, LD, recorded video tapes, some parts of digital satellite broadcasts, etc.
